i would say that people who like rap are probably like people who like trance, some are cool and some are asses. alot of it has to do with maturity too, if youre 16 and think just because you like rap you cant listen to trance cause someone told you its pussy music, then youll probably act all gangster. but a lot of people do it with trance too, they decide its so much "better" then everything else and run down other genres and even on boards like this, each other. this is kind of what lead me to make this poll

Rap vs. Trance
Before I recently got into trance I was a giant rap fan. I still like it a lot, I actually think it's funny that people contrast the two genres -- I think they have a ton in common. I think rap pushed me towards trance, I love hearing the awesome beats and effects and production, so the next step for electronically-produced music was trance. Even though I've pretty much bumped "gangsta" rap from my playlists (still some softer hiphop on there), I still need it for the gym... trance relaxes me and makes me too happy, I need the aggressive angry gangsta beatz.
